Travelling on a luxury adventure will be very exciting, but before that, one needs to know the basics of travel preparation. Both nations demand proper documentation, and the passport should have at least six months’ validity after your travel dates. The visa regulations are also dependent on nationality; most people travelling to Australia require visas to enter the country, whereas New Zealand has been more lenient to people holding most passports.

Timing Your Luxury Journey
When you visit, it also plays a significant role in the quality of your experience, as well as the luxury of the accommodations available. The best times in both countries are spring (March to May) and autumn (September to November) when the weather is pleasant and there are fewer people at popular places. Luxury resorts and high-quality tour operators typically offer the highest service levels during these periods, as weather conditions are most conducive to outdoor activities and sightseeing.

Packing and Preparation for Diverse Climates
Australia and New Zealand boast varying climatic conditions that can only be met by clever packing techniques. The vast Australian continent encompasses a range of regions, including tropical, temperate, and arid areas, which necessitate multifunctional clothing. There should be layers according to the changes in temperature, good walking shoes that consider various terrains, and sun protection during outdoor activities. High-quality tour operators may even give you a list of what to pack depending on the itinerary you have set and seasonal packing suggestions.
The weather in New Zealand is prone to sudden changes, especially in the mountainous areas and along the coast. When visiting places like Fiordland National Park or the Southern Alps, waterproof clothing and shoes are essential. Most luxury tours will pack specialized equipment applicable to a particular activity; however, items related to personal comfort and favourite outdoor wear should also be considered when packing.
